@charly4711 speaking of texture streaming.
I found out that I had three 2K/4K world texture mods (meaning all textures, ads, walls, streets, grass, windows, etc....).
These 3 mods where overlapping one on another while only 2 of them were compatible.
So I removed one and now I can drive without any problems.
This must have been a "calculating fever" even for an NVME SSD...
I also removed a LOD mod and kept a very low performance one.
The game also is even smoother.
